Transaction 70cb72abc3c5f61332138032ff0083f5d5b88659c520c723a624aa34ec925b21
1 Input
1 Output
-
70cb72abc3c5f61332138032ff0083f5d5b88659c520c723a624aa34ec925b21:0
- value
- 546000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20522099257079351ca9c3787feab0c0a29bbd3c OP_EQUAL
- address
- 34duvzMhWVwyyBdY1v78xw1iyiSquVNiYs